### Nightfill Scheduler API

The Nightfill scheduler queues backfill jobs for the Orrel data warehouse. POST a job spec to /v2/backfills with a target table, date range, and priority. Jobs run between 01:00 and 05:00 UTC; anything queued later rolls to the next window. All endpoints require bearer authentication. Staging tokens are shared across the team and rotate monthly. For staging requests, authenticate with the token below.

session JWT of yawep-yawep = eyJhbGciOiJIUzI1NiIsInR5cCI6IkpXVCJ9.eyJzdWIiOiI3pWF3_In0.aXYsHiog

Ticket: Staging env misconfigured for Siftgate bloom filter

The bloom layer in front of the Pellet KV store is rejecting all lookups in staging because the env file was copied from the dev template without credentials. False-positive tuning values are fine; only the auth line is missing. To unblock the weekly demo, the Pellet admission secret must be set on the following line.

env line for yaguf-fajop: LEDGER_TOKEN13=fb08984397349

## Fee rules engine: restart procedure

The Cartwell shipping-fee rules engine evaluates rule sets loaded at boot. If fees are computing incorrectly, first check whether a recent rule publish failed validation; the engine falls back to the last good set and logs a warning. A restart forces a fresh load. Do not restart during the nightly reconciliation window, since in-flight quotes would be repriced. The engine starts with the values listed here.

deployment values, yahag-tawef:
ZORWYN_HOST=zorwyn.tolvaqlabs.internal
ZORWYN_PORT=9300

## Parcel-Tracking Webhook

When reviewing changes to the Swiftroute webhook handler, confirm that every inbound event from Packlane is verified against the HMAC header before any database write. Retries are idempotent keyed on `event_id`; duplicates must be dropped silently. Replay tooling lives in `tools/replay`. The handler forwards verified events to the internal Trackbus service, authenticating with the key below.

service key, bajof-kawif: kto4_Bp1v